WebApr 12, 2024 · The Agreement determines disciplines for WTO members engaged in harmful fisheries subsidies, and marks the first ever multilateral agreement that has … WebOn February 25, 1998 President Fidel V. Ramos signed into law Republic Act No. 8550, entitled, "An Act Providing For the Development, Management and Conservation of the Fisheries and Aquatic Resources, Integrating all laws pertinent thereto and for other purposes", otherwise known as the Philippine Fisheries Code of 1998.

WebNOAA Fisheries regulates commercial and recreational marine fishing in the United States under the Magnuson-Stevens Fishery Conservation and Management Act (MSA). [17] [18] Established in 1976, the MSA is the primary law governing marine fisheries conservation and management in U.S. federal waters. WebSustainable Fisheries Act. The Sustainable Fisheries Act of 1996 enacted numerous science, management, and conservation mandates. It recognized the importance of healthy habitat for commercial and recreational fisheries.
